WebThe majority of the book takes place between May 28, 1944, and June 6, 1944. The number of events that took place between those dates is very realistic. From the initial bombing of the Chateau to the taking over of the Chateau by the Jackdaws. Follet effectively portrays how time passes through the novel, using dates after certain events to ... WebJackdaw. Jackdaws are two species of bird in the genus Coloeus closely related to, but generally smaller than, crows and ravens ( Corvus ). They have a blackish crown, wings and tail, the rest of the plumage being paler. [2] The word Coloeus is New Latin, from the Ancient Greek for jackdaws: koloiós ( κολοιός ).
